one. Explosion Evidence Lights
What exactly are Explosion Evidence Lights?
Explosion-evidence lights are specifically designed lighting fixtures that could properly function in environments the place explosive gases, vapors, dust, or fibers may be present. These lights are developed to ensure that the electrical elements inside the fixture never ignite the surrounding atmosphere, thereby stopping explosions in dangerous locations.

Importance in Industrial Environments
Industries like oil and gasoline, chemical processing, mining, and production often operate in hazardous places the place flammable substances are prevalent. Explosion-evidence lights are essential for preserving security in these kinds of environments, making certain the protection of personnel and preventing costly incidents.

Features of Explosion Evidence Lights
Toughness: Made to resist severe environmental ailments like Excessive temperatures, vibration, and exposure to chemicals.
Sealed Design: Explosion-evidence lights are sealed in order that no inside sparks or heat can escape, reducing the potential risk of ignition.
Corrosion Resistance: The resources employed, often chrome steel or aluminum, resist corrosion in harsh environments.
Apps
Explosion-proof lights are Employed in refineries, offshore oil platforms, chemical vegetation, and grain processing amenities. In any place where by flammable gases, dust, or liquids are current, these lights provide important illumination with no compromising safety.

two. ATEX Certified Transportable Lights
What exactly is ATEX Certification?
ATEX certification is a European standard for machines used in explosive atmospheres. The name derives within the French phrase "ATmosphères EXplosibles." ATEX-Licensed moveable lights are designed to fulfill these stringent security necessities, ensuring they can safely be Employed in dangerous environments without the risk of igniting explosive gases, dust, or vapors.

Characteristics of ATEX Accredited Transportable Lights
Portability: These lights are often lightweight and easy to carry, creating them ideal for mobile duties in harmful parts.
Prolonged Battery Everyday living: Most ATEX-certified portable lights come with long-lasting batteries to make sure continuous operation in the course of fieldwork or emergency scenarios.
Rugged Construction: These are constructed to withstand tough handling and harsh environmental problems, which include dampness, dust, and Excessive temperatures.
Programs
ATEX-Accredited transportable lights are important in many sectors, which includes unexpected emergency companies, routine maintenance crews, oil and gasoline, and chemical industries. These are employed for inspections, maintenance tasks, and short term lighting in environments wherever basic safety is vital.

three. Dangerous Spot Lighting
Overview of Hazardous Area Lights
Dangerous location lights is usually a broad classification that includes any lights Remedy intended to function properly in explosive or hazardous environments. These spots are usually described from the existence of flammable gases, vapors, or dust. Appropriate lights is essential for protection and productiveness, enabling employees to view Evidently without having compromising the protection of your surroundings.

Forms of Dangerous Region Lighting
Explosion Evidence Lights: As previously reviewed, they are built to include any sparks or heat created by the fixture, avoiding them from igniting harmful substances.
Flameproof Lights: Similar to explosion-proof lights, flameproof lights are manufactured to stop any interior ignition resources from achieving the skin ecosystem.
Intrinsically Secure Lighting: This lighting is made so which the electrical circuits cannot create ample warmth or spark to ignite an explosive environment, regardless of whether damaged.
Significance of Appropriate Installation and Upkeep
Proper installation and typical servicing of dangerous spot lighting are necessary to guarantee basic safety. Improperly set up lights or neglecting upkeep can result in accidents or gear failure.

Applications
Hazardous space lights is broadly Utilized in industries including oil refineries, chemical plants, offshore platforms, and coal mines. It makes certain that functions keep on securely even in environments prone to explosion risks.

6. Ultrasonic Move Meter
What on earth is an Ultrasonic Movement Meter?
An ultrasonic move meter is a device that steps the velocity of a fluid through the use of ultrasonic sound waves. These meters are accustomed to evaluate the movement of liquids or gases in industrial purposes, without having demanding contact with the fluid by itself.

Operating Theory
Ultrasonic move meters perform by sending seem waves with the fluid and measuring enough time it's going to take for your waves to journey from one level to a different. The difference in travel time is accustomed to work out the fluid’s velocity and, in turn, its movement amount.

Benefits of Ultrasonic Flow Meters
Non-Invasive: Considering that ultrasonic move meters do not demand contact with the fluid, they are perfect for apps where by contamination should be avoided.
Large Accuracy: These meters give remarkably exact move measurements, making them suitable for crucial industrial processes.
Reduced Upkeep: Without any shifting elements, ultrasonic movement meters are minimal upkeep when compared with other circulation measurement units.
Programs
Ultrasonic movement meters are used in industries such as h2o cure, oil and gasoline, chemical processing, and HVAC programs. They are commonly used to evaluate the circulation of water, substances, and petroleum products and solutions.

seven. RTD Temperature Sensors
What exactly is an RTD Temperature Sensor?
RTD (Resistance Temperature Detector) sensors are gadgets utilized to evaluate temperature by correlating the resistance from the sensor element with temperature. As temperature variations, the resistance with the RTD sensor component also changes, allowing for precise temperature measurement.

Functions of RTD Temperature Sensors
High Precision: RTD sensors offer specific temperature measurements, producing them ideal for significant industrial processes.
Steadiness: RTD sensors supply fantastic prolonged-term balance, making sure trustworthy measurements over time.
Extensive Temperature Range: These sensors can measure temperatures starting from -two hundred°C to 850°C.
Programs
RTD temperature sensors are generally Employed in industries like food items and beverage, pharmaceuticals, and electricity technology. They tend to be utilized in system Manage programs, HVAC machines, and laboratory settings.

8. Ultrasonic Degree Transducers
What exactly is an Ultrasonic Amount Transducer?
Ultrasonic level transducers are products that use sound waves to evaluate the level of liquids or solids in a very container. By emitting ultrasonic pulses and measuring the time it will require for your echoes to return, these transducers can precisely establish the level of the material in a tank or silo.

Advantages of Ultrasonic Amount Transducers
Non-Speak to Measurement: Ultrasonic transducers do not have to have connection with the material becoming measured, producing them perfect for corrosive or dangerous liquids.
Versatility: These transducers can measure amounts of both liquids and solids, producing them remarkably multipurpose for industrial programs.
Reduced Upkeep: Without having shifting parts, ultrasonic degree transducers have to have negligible upkeep.
Apps
Ultrasonic degree transducers are commonly used in industries which include h2o remedy, chemical processing, and food stuff and beverage generation. They are commonly used to observe tank stages, handle inventory, and Command automated processes.

nine. Magnetic Level Indicators
What's a Magnetic Level Indicator?
A magnetic degree indicator (MLI) is a device used to evaluate and Show the extent of liquid within a tank or vessel. It makes use of a float made up of a magnet that rises and falls Along with the liquid level, driving a visual indicator to Display screen the level externally.

Functions of Magnetic Level Indicators
Visual Readout: MLIs offer a crystal clear, effortless-to-study Visible indicator with the liquid degree, making them user-pleasant.
No Energy Prerequisite: Magnetic amount indicators operate devoid of electrical energy, building them perfect for remote or hazardous locations.
Sturdiness: MLIs are crafted to withstand harsh industrial ailments, such as Extraordinary temperatures and corrosive environments.
Programs
Magnetic stage indicators are generally Utilized in industries for example oil and fuel, chemical processing, and h2o treatment. They may be specially practical in applications exactly where electrical power is just not readily available or where by Digital amount measurement is not really possible.

ten. Reverse Osmosis Watermaker
Exactly what is a Reverse Osmosis Watermaker?
A reverse osmosis (RO) watermaker is a method used to purify h2o by eradicating salts, contaminants, and impurities via a semipermeable membrane. RO watermakers are generally Utilized in industrial, marine, and commercial purposes to generate clean up, potable h2o.

How Reverse Osmosis Will work
The reverse osmosis approach includes forcing water through a membrane that blocks contaminants though allowing for cleanse drinking water to pass through. The membrane separates dissolved salts, microbes, and various impurities, manufacturing purified drinking water ideal for ingesting, industrial processes, or irrigation.

Benefits of Reverse Osmosis Watermakers
Significant Effectiveness: RO watermakers are highly successful in eliminating impurities, providing clean up water for a variety of programs.
Cost-Productive: These techniques lessen the need to have for bottled h2o and also other pricey drinking water purification methods.
Very low Maintenance: Present day RO watermakers are designed for ease of servicing, ensuring extended-time period dependable operation.
Purposes
Reverse osmosis watermakers are widely Utilized in maritime environments, industrial procedures, and municipal h2o therapy services. They offer critical water purification remedies for industries which include pharmaceuticals, foods and beverage, and electricity technology.
